Output 7027ef72a2bdb52bc945b576b2497633bc5bb602c1c9b5e871b66524e4a9aaf6:121

value
20431960
script pubkey
OP_0 OP_PUSHBYTES_20 d0cabb718af04382e23a83d885f403b8c93d994a
address
bc1q6r9tkuv27ppc9c36s0vgtaqrhrynmx22gxru2s
transaction
7027ef72a2bdb52bc945b576b2497633bc5bb602c1c9b5e871b66524e4a9aaf6